Construct a Budget That Reflects Your Life


A spending plan is not one-size-fits-all. It's individual. It must reflect not simply your revenue and expenses, yet your worths, your way of living, and your objectives. Some individuals are comfortable with spread sheets; others choose budgeting apps or even the old envelope system. Pick an approach that matches your routines-- not another person's.


If you're simply beginning, an easy 50/30/20 guideline can help:



  • 50% of your earnings goes toward needs

  • 30% toward desires

  • 20% toward savings or financial debt payback


Yet that's only a starting factor. Some months will be leaner, others a lot more flexible. Your spending plan should develop with your life.


And do not fail to remember to pay yourself first. Also a tiny regular monthly payment to your personal savings account builds energy. With time, it becomes a habit, not an obstacle.

Take Advantage Of the Right Tools for Financial Growth


Your cash needs to function for you, not vice versa. That's why it pays to use the best monetary tools-- like check here high interest checking accounts that reward your balance, or low-fee choices that do not eat into your savings.


Not all accounts are produced equal. Some checking accounts currently use returns that competing standard savings accounts, especially when you satisfy specific regular monthly requirements like direct deposit or a set number of deals. These high interest checking accounts transform everyday investing into a passive development chance-- no additional initiative required.


Also, credit union credit cards usually come with reduced interest rates, fewer costs, and member-focused rewards. They're designed with your economic health in mind, not just the bottom line of a significant financial institution. If you're constructing or reconstructing debt, utilizing your card properly-- and paying it off in full each month-- can significantly boost your score over time.


Long-Term Planning Starts at Home


Considering the future? Whether you're desiring for a new place to call your own or seeking to refinance, home mortgages can seem daunting in the beginning. Yet they do not have to be. With the advice of financial experts that prioritize your benefit, navigating the procedure ends up being much less demanding.


The secret is preparation. Before applying for a home mortgage, know your credit rating, your debt-to-income ratio, and just how much home you can actually pay for-- not simply based on what you're approved for, however what fits your spending plan easily.

Credit Isn't the Enemy-- It's a Tool


Credit obtains a bad rap. Yet used intelligently, it can be one of your most effective tools for building economic toughness. From financing significant purchases to leveraging lending institution charge card for incentives and comfort, debt uses adaptability-- if you appreciate its power.


Remain disciplined. Establish notifies to remind you of repayment due days. Maintain your utilization reduced-- preferably under 30% of your overall available credit rating. And prevent making an application for several credit lines in a brief amount of time. Accountable credit rating usage opens doors-- literally, if you're checking out home mortgages.
